Transaction 5ab95cf703e30e41fd167ea20ad14da90b1f11217970d0d11b1ba18677a4ada7

1 Input
2 Outputs
  • 5ab95cf703e30e41fd167ea20ad14da90b1f11217970d0d11b1ba18677a4ada7:0
  • value  746887
    address  mkkxCwhfzbzEAPbpqR5YrAXns9P9NKam4k
  • 5ab95cf703e30e41fd167ea20ad14da90b1f11217970d0d11b1ba18677a4ada7:1
  • value  151195904
    address  n3bpaxHt4D5nszgUyPr1UdFE5J4mfiNo7R